A lip reader has revealed what Taylor Swift said after getting booed at the Super Bowl on Sunday.

The singer, 35, was left stunned after being met with emphatic booing at the Caesars Superdome when she appeared on the jumbotron for the first time.

The action happened before her boyfriend Travis Kelce’s Kansas City Chiefs were defeated by the Philadelphia Eagles. 

Taylor was caught looking sideways after receiving boos before talking to a friend. Lip reader NJ Hickling reportedly shared with DailyMail.com that the singer said ‘aww what, what’s going on.’

Taylor and Travis’, 35, seemingly happy time together may have faced a setback, as the NFL star experienced a devastating loss at the Super Bowl shortly after the singer felt ignored at the Grammys.

All attention was on the pair on Sunday when Travis’ team, the Kansas City Chiefs, faced off against the Philadelphia Eagles, ultimately suffering a disappointing 22-40 defeat.

With the stadium seemingly boasting more Philadelphia Eagles fans than members of Chiefs Kingdom, Swift did not get a nice reception when cameras zoomed in on her before the carnage unfolded. 

The star appeared to notice the booing, giving a mocking side-eye response as the noise mercilessly rang out around the packed stadium.

Swift didn’t look impressed, and President Donald Trump didn’t waste the opportunity to taunt his nemesis on Truth Social after making history by becoming the first sitting President to go to a Super Bowl.

‘The only one that had a tougher night than the Kansas City Chiefs was Taylor Swift. She got BOOED out of the Stadium. MAGA is very unforgiving!’ Trump wrote.

Trump also shared footage of Swift getting booed from all corners of the stadium, comparing it to how he was cheered when he appeared on the jumbotron before the national anthem.

But her pal Serena Williams leapt to her defense, posting on X: ‘I love you @taylorswift13 dont listen to those booo!!’

Taylor showed ‘grim support’ for Travis according to a body language expert.

The Bad Blood singer appeared at the game wearing an all-white ensemble to cheer on Kelce. Despite a rocky start, which saw the Eagles lead the scoreboard almost immediately, and boos from the crowd, Swift proudly supported Kelce throughout the entire night. 

Things began to take a turn early on, however, with the Chiefs going into halftime with zero points.

‘Taylor Swift began in signature sweetheart mode, dressed in sparkly shorts and a white vest, she looked as excited and busy as usual in the VIP section, chatting and whispering with one hand over her mouth like a teenage fan,’ body language expert Judi James told DailyMail.com exclusively.

‘The mood music changed dramatically though. With her boyfriend’s team losing badly by halftime and Travis standing dejected below her, wincing as he wiped his hand over his forehead in a gesture of bewilderment, Taylor looked more like haunting presence,’ James continued.

‘Standing in a solitary pose on the balcony now, she gazed out at her lover unsmiling with her hands splayed and gripping the rail in a gesture of grim support.’

The score wasn’t the only disappointment for Swift during the game. As she sat in her box with famous friends Ice Spice and the Haim sisters, Swift also faced intense jeers from Eagles’ fans.

But, according to James, Swift kept her composure and was a ‘good sport’ through it all.

‘She held her pose bravely but her eyes rolled to one side and then the other in a gesture of disbelief,’ James remarked.

Kelce fought back tears on his return to the Kansas City Chiefs locker room before later reuniting with Taylor following the most humiliating night of his career. 

The devastated Chiefs tight end had misery etched across his face as Kansas City’s ‘three-peat’ dreams ended in disarray.

‘Hats off to the Eagles, man. We couldn’t get it going offensively,’ Kelce said to reporters in the locker room. ‘We just couldn’t find that spark, couldn’t find that momentum.’

Kelce said he believed at halftime that the Chiefs could turn the game around.

‘100% believed,’ he said. ‘Never lose doubt. I think there was a lot of things going wrong.’

‘Everything was not really going our way today. You don’t lose like that without everything going bad.’

Last weekend, Swifties were left fearing that her shock snub at the Grammys could be foreshadowing a Super Bowl loss for boyfriend Travis.

Sunday night saw the pop superstar failed to win any of the six nominations she had on the night, including Album of the Year.

It was an unexpected result for the star who rarely ever leaves an awards show empty-handed.

Taylor and Travis were first linked romantically in early September 2023, following Travis’ mention of trying to give Swift a friendship bracelet at one of her concerts.

Their relationship quickly captured the public’s attention, with the couple making their first official appearance together at the Kansas City Chiefs’ game on September 24, 2023.
